Can you do other graphics printing, e.g. from Netscape? If so then
ghostscript is working there.

  There is a 'bug' in the print scripts, so that if ghostscript fails
to read the postscript, the error message goes to the printer, instead
of the screen, or a log file, or e-mail.

   It looks like ghostscript is failing. Maybe you could try a newer (or
older) version. Do the Star Office manuals say what version of ghostscript
it has been tested with?
